キャンベラのスパイ、二重スパイ、秘密工作の隠された世界に足を踏み入れましょう。郊外の平凡な通りの裏に潜む秘密を探り、スパイだった、スパイされていた女性たちの信じられない(最近は機密扱いになっていない)物語を聞いてみましょう。
このツアーでは、悪名高いパブ、放棄された大使館、常に監視されていた家を訪問します。スパイの帽子をかぶって、冷戦時代にキャンベラ周辺で工作員が使用したテクニックのいくつかを学ぶことも求められます。
スパイ物語のファンでも、キャンベラの歴史を楽しく紹介したいだけでも、このツアーはあなたにぴったりです。オーストラリアの首都の知られざる過去を明らかにするこの素晴らしい機会をお見逃しなく。
